The AHS Answer for Cancer Club is hosting a fundraising event to benefit the Jimmy Fund and the Dana Farber Cancer Institute on Saturday, April 1 from 12 - 3. There will be an 18 Hole Mini Golf Course set up in the cafeteria as well as a Hole-In-One contest, face painting, corn hole, caricatures, raffles, food, and prizes. Admission is $10.00 per person and children under 12 are only $5.00 which includes everything except food. All proceeds benefit the Jimmy Fund for Pediatric Cancer research and support. In an effort to return our elementary students home before conditions become unsafe, APS will dismiss early today, Tuesday, March 14, 2023. The early dismissal times are as follows: High School: 10:50 AM Middle School: 11:30 AM Elementary School: 12:25 PM The Early Learning Center will be closed - no AM or PM preschool. The ABACUS program will close two hours after dismissal.
